After meeting Professor Muhammad Yunus at the One Young World Summit 2010, Lucia was inspired to devote herself to social business and founded DUHEM, the first Latin American online market-place devoted to social consumers and cause-orientated brands. DUHEM gathers the coolest, socially conscious brands and products which give back to society on a single platform (www.duhem.co). All products directly support social causes from education and health to environment and human rights. The market currently offers more than 4,000 products from 80 social businesses contributing to the sustainability of dozens of small and medium enterprises. 92% of DUHEMs suppliers are SMEs and 75% are led by women. In 2013, Lucia was recognised by the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) as an Innovator Under 35 becoming the first Peruvian to receive this award. DUHEM was also selected as one of the start-ups incubated by Wayra, Telefonica's IT accelerator, receiving $50,000 in mentorship and work space over 10 months.
